Course Goal

To provide basic literature on the paradigm of ecology and design; To introduce ecological design principles; To introduce the contemporary approaches in ecological landscape design; To discuss the design solutions based on environmental performance in urban space.

Course Content

Introduction and basic concepts; Climate and bioclimate, bioclimatic comfort and emerging conditions, topography, soil and water conditions, vegetation cover; Ecological and energy efficient landscape design criteria: The concept of energy efficient site selection, energy efficient optimum orientation concept, design criteria and principles in external structural usage areas, surface properties and material efficient landscape design principles, water efficient landscape design principles, energy efficient site selection principles for green spaces, relations between green spaces and bioclimate, choice of plant species according to form, volume, color and texture; New concepts, theories and technologies in ecological design, sample applications.

Course Learning Outcomes

Order Course Learning Outcomes
LO01 Learn basic concepts of human interactions that affect ecological systems.
LO02 Learn the approaches and principles in ecological landscape design.
LO03 Gain the ability to develop critical thought and to discuss the design solutions based on environmental performance proposed by landscape design projects.
LO04 Learn to access sources of primary scientific literature on environmental effects of landscape interventions.
LO05 To evaluate and discuss ecological design projects.
